Background
The container has a storage function and generally comprises a body and a handle, wherein the body is carried by the handle, the handle is arranged on the side surface of the body and extends outwards, and a user holds the handle to move the container; such as a frying pan, a lunch box and the like, and also belongs to a container.
When the container in the prior art is not used, the handle extends out of the side face of the body, so that the container is inconvenient to store, and meanwhile, a user can easily touch the handle to cause the container to fall;
therefore, containers with a handle capable of being rotatably accommodated are beginning to appear on the market, and one way of the containers is as follows: the side surface of the body is provided with the jack, the handle is of an elastic connecting arm structure, and the tail end of the elastic connecting arm is clamped in the jack;
however, the above-mentioned method has a new technical problem of how to stably maintain the handle in the unfolded state and prevent the handle from automatically rotating and storing in the process of use and movement.

A collapsible container, as shown in fig. 1-4, includes: the container body 100 and the handle 200, the handle 200 is rotatably connected to the side of the container body 100, so that the container body 100 and the handle 200 can be relatively unfolded and stored.
The handle 200 is provided with a first connecting arm 210 and a second connecting arm 220 at one end connected with the container body 100, and the front ends of the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are connected, so that the tail ends of the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 can be elastically clamped in opposite directions or opened back to back.
The side of the container body 100 is provided with a fixing seat 130 with a fixing lug 120, and the ends of the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are inserted into the fixing lug 120 and can rotate, so that the container body 100 and the handle 200 can be in a relatively unfolded state and a relatively accommodated state.
The side of the container body 100 is provided with the buckling block 110, the side of the buckling block 110 is provided with the buckling groove 111 and the protrusion 112, when the handle 200 rotates and expands,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 rotate to the position of the protrusion 112, the protrusion 112 is abutted against the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220, so that the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are deformed towards the clamping direction or the opening direction to be abutted against the protrusion 112 tightly, and after the handle 200 continues to rotate, the handle separates from the protrusion 112 and enters the buckling groove 111.
Further,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 cannot be separated from the card slot 111 independently under the obstruction of the protrusion 112;
furthermore,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are deformed in the clamping direction or the opening direction to be tightly attached to the engaging groove 111.
When the handle 200 is rotated to store,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are moved away from the engaging groove 111 by external force, overcoming the obstruction of the protrusion 112, and then are rotated to store.
In one embodiment, the number of the fastening blocks 110 is 1; a clamping space is formed between the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220, and after the handle 200 rotates and expands, the buckling block 110 is positioned in the clamping space formed by the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220, so that the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are limited under the obstruction of the upper convex part 112 of the buckling block 110 and cannot rotate independently, and the handle 200 and the container body 100 are kept in an expanded state.
The first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are deformed when abutting against the protrusion 112, and when the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 leave the protrusion 112 and correspond to the slot 111,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are restored and are clamped into the slot 111.
Further, the fixing seat 130 and the fastening block 110 may be of an integral structure or a split structure, and here, an integral structure is preferred.
The fixing base 130 may be fixedly connected to the container body 100 by a screw, and the fastening block 110 is located below the fixing lug 120.
Further,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are symmetrically arranged, the ends of the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are both formed with a first bent portion 201 and a second bent portion 202, and the second bent portion 202 is inserted into the mounting hole 121; the first bent portion 201 abuts against a side surface of the container body 100 when the handle 200 and the container body 100 are in the unfolded state. The front ends of the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are connected, and a holding part 230 is provided, the shape of the holding part 230 is not limited, as long as the purpose of facilitating holding can be achieved.
As shown in fig. 2, the handle 200 is formed by bending a metal rod to form a substantially U-shape, and the first bent portion 201 and the second bent portion 202 formed by bending the ends of the U-shape are further attached to the U-shaped metal rod by the above-mentioned holding member 230; compared with the prior art that various limiting parts are arranged in the handle to realize limiting so as to prevent the handle from automatically rotating, the novel handle has the advantages of simple structure, lower cost and more convenience in installation.
The second bending portion 202 is bent and extended outwards relatively horizontally, so that when the handle 200 is installed,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 of the handle 200 are clamped oppositely and deformed, so that the distance between the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 is shortened, the distance between the two second bending portions 202 can enter the position between the two fixing lugs 120 after being shortened, after the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are released,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are opened under the action of restoring force, and meanwhile, the two second bending portions 202 are smoothly clamped into the fixing lugs 120.
The mode has simple structure and convenient assembly.
In one embodiment, as shown in fig. 5, the locking block 110 is a plate, 2 locking blocks 110 are provided, the locking blocks 110 are located outside the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220, and when the handle 200 is unfolded,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are located between the two locking blocks 110 and are locked into the locking groove 111 against the obstruction of the protrusion 112.
The second bending portion 202 is bent and extended inward relatively to the horizontal direction, so that when the handle 200 is installed,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 of the handle 200 are firstly opened back to back and deformed, so that the distance between the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 is enlarged, the distance between the two second bending portions 202 can correspond to the outer sides of the two fixing lugs 120 after being enlarged, after the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are released, the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are clamped under the action of restoring force, and meanwhile, the two second bending portions 202 are smoothly clamped into the fixing lugs 120.
By the above, the handle 200 can be easily detached, rotatably stored, and positioned after being unfolded.
Further, as shown in fig. 1 and 5, in the process that the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 enter the slot 111 and are separated from the slot 111, the acting force of the protrusion 112 acting on the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 causes deformation between the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220, and then the first connecting arm 210 and the second connecting arm 220 are clamped into the slot 111; meanwhile, the installation of the second bending part 202 is not affected in the using process; similarly, during the use of the container (i.e. when the handle 200 is unfolded relative to the container body 100), the second bending portion 202 will not be accidentally separated from the mounting hole 121 due to the obstruction of the locking block 110.
